Asphalt Paving Foreman

This is a traveling position!

Job Summary

The Asphalt Paving Foreman / Crew Leader will directly oversee a crew of personnel performing various aspects of an asphalt paving operation.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Manage personnel on crews
  • Maintain quality of product (i.e. smoothness and thickness)
  • Maintain and work with all asphalt paving equipment
  • Communicate direction from Asphalt Paving Superintendent to staff
  • Calculate materials including the spread rate and yield of asphalt
  • Report quantities to supervisor on a daily basis
  • Schedule and track crew's labor time
  • Ensure all safety requirements are met
